Hi I'm concerned about what I should eat to try and stay at CKD3a. I eat a plant-based whole foods diet (vegetarian/vegan) which includes daily beans, nuts and seeds. Having read a fair bit about diet and CKD I wonder whether I should limit my protein? Also are whole grains worse for CKD than refined versions (e.g. Rice, bread)

Hi New starter,

I'm not a professional but conversations with my GP have lead me to improve my GFR by 5 points in a year.

I avoid;

Red meat and pork, fresh chicken is not so bad..

processed meats (hams bacon etc due to salt content) this includes peperoni and salami, these are also on pizza so think where you encounter these!

All processed ready meals and fast food(high salt content)

Potatoes (high potasium, allegedly affects blood pressure) if i do have them i soak in water overnight to leech the potasium out of them.

Bananas (potasium)

Raisins,

Nuts (especially salted)

Yogurt

Alcahol

Coffee/Teas especially cafinated.

Ketchup (high sugar)

Energy drinks and Cokes (high sugar)

Saturated fats and sugars (biscuits and crackers)

NSAID type pain killers such as ibuprofen...

All high fibre foods as these take longer to digest and hold BP higher whilst digesting.

Keep animal protien intake to 60g per day, eat vegtarian, freshly prepared foods are a must. dont add salt

When i have a heavy meal (Big or hard to digest) i have a warm apple cider vinegar drink (diluted)as this allegedly aids digestion and it seems to work for me. The most important thing is to keep calm avoid stress and keep your BP down. Lose weight and exercise lightly. Drink lots of water (1.5 - 2ltrs per day) and ensure you buy bottled water but watch the mineral content (sodium and potassium are in bottled waters).

Seek medical advice or discuss with a professional, as i said i am doing well but not a professional!
